diff --git a/sys/posix4/_semaphore.h b/sys/posix4/_semaphore.h index 2c330e881fe7..91106ff99e51 100644 --- a/sys/posix4/_semaphore.h +++ b/sys/posix4/_semaphore.h @@ -29,6 +29,7 @@ #define __SEMAPHORE_H_ typedef intptr_t semid_t; +struct timespec; #ifndef _KERNEL diff --git a/sys/posix4/semaphore.h b/sys/posix4/semaphore.h index f451d5f6dc71..180625221f2e 100644 --- a/sys/posix4/semaphore.h +++ b/sys/posix4/semaphore.h @@ -47,6 +47,8 @@ typedef struct sem * sem_t; #ifndef _KERNEL #include +struct timespec; + __BEGIN_DECLS int sem_close(sem_t *); int sem_destroy(sem_t *); diff --git a/sys/sys/_semaphore.h b/sys/sys/_semaphore.h index 2c330e881fe7..91106ff99e51 100644 --- a/sys/sys/_semaphore.h +++ b/sys/sys/_semaphore.h @@ -29,6 +29,7 @@ #define __SEMAPHORE_H_ typedef intptr_t semid_t; +struct timespec; #ifndef _KERNEL diff --git a/sys/sys/semaphore.h b/sys/sys/semaphore.h index f451d5f6dc71..180625221f2e 100644 --- a/sys/sys/semaphore.h +++ b/sys/sys/semaphore.h @@ -47,6 +47,8 @@ typedef struct sem * sem_t; #ifndef _KERNEL #include +struct timespec; + __BEGIN_DECLS int sem_close(sem_t *); int sem_destroy(sem_t *);